The episode doubles down on the relatable Italian family dynamic. The "empty chair" at the Christmas table isn't just a furniture problem; it’s a symbol of her mother’s expectations, making Gianna’s lies feel increasingly heavy.

Unlike many Christmas shows set in generic snowy towns, the show uses Chioggia (often called "Little Venice") and Venice itself to create a specific mood. In Episode 2, the foggy, damp, and slightly melancholy atmosphere of the canals mirrors Gianna’s feeling of being "adrift" in her single life. Odio il Natale s01e02

This episode features a classic, cringe-worthy speed dating sequence. It perfectly captures Gianna’s internal conflict—she’s a nurse who deals with life and death every day, yet she feels totally incompetent at the "game" of finding a partner under a deadline.
